I still carry a large bag but that's because I've always carried a large purse (it is actually a diaper bag but it just looks like a purse), but I have pared down dramatically the stuff for DS I put in it. Basically a few diapers, wipes, paci and a burp cloths (for spills) and I throw a random toy in if I think DS might need/want one. If we're going to be out for the day and away from the car (where I always keep a change a clothes), I throw a change of clothes in the bag too. So, yes, I think by this age, you can easily ditch a large diaper bag on most days.

I stopped carrying a bigger bag when DD1 was maybe 3. We switched to a backpack at maybe 1.5 or so, because we didn't need all the blankets, and bottles, and food stuff. Thing is, you still need diapers, wipes, cream, change of clothes, and a few little things (which you'll continue to need even when they've started potty training).
I'm all for switching to a smaller backpack, but one for you, not your LO. Kids are not responsible and odds are he's going to lose it or leave it somewhere, or it's going to go missing - when you need it.
